A:The gospel story of the beheading of John the Baptist concerns Herodias, wife of Herod Antipas, Tetrarch of Galilee and son of King Herod.

The historical record frees her of blame for this act, since John the Baptist was actually executed in faraway Macherus and on the direct orders of Antipas, as stated by the first-century Jewish historian, Josephus. The relevant text from Book 18 of Antiquities of the Jews:

"Now many people came in crowds to him, for they were greatly moved by his words. Herod, who feared that the great influence John had over the masses might put them into his power and enable him to raise a rebellion (for they seemed ready to do anything he should advise), thought it best to put him to death. In this way, he might prevent any mischief John might cause, and not bring himself into difficulties by sparing a man who might make him repent of it when it would be too late. Accordingly John was sent as a prisoner, out of Herod's suspicious temper, to Macherus, the castle I already mentioned, and was put to death."
